دستورالعمل‌های جی کوئری - روش wrapInner()

مثال

یک عنصر b را حول محتوای هر عنصر p بپوشانید:

$(".btn1").click(function(){
   $("p").wrapInner("<b></b>");
});

خودتان امتحان کنید

تعریف و استفاده

مетод wrapInner() از محتوای HTML یا عنصر مشخص شده برای پوشاندن هر محتوای داخلی (HTML داخلی) هر عنصر انتخاب شده استفاده می‌کند.

منطق

$().wrapInner(پوشاننده)
پارامترها توضیح
پوشاننده

ضروری است. محتوایی که باید در اطراف محتوای انتخاب شده پوشانده شود را مشخص کنید.

ممکنه‌ها:

  • کد HTML - مثلاً ("<div></div>")
  • عناصر جدید DOM - مثلاً (document.createElement("div"))
  • عناصر موجود - مثلاً ($(".div1"))

عناصر موجود منتقل نمی‌شوند، فقط کپی می‌شوند و حول عناصر انتخاب شده بسته می‌شوند.

از تابع برای پوشاندن محتوا استفاده کنید

از تابع برای تعیین محتوایی که در اطراف هر عنصر انتخاب شده قرار می‌گیرد، استفاده کنید.

منطق

$().wrapInner(تابع())

خودتان امتحان کنید

پارامترها توضیح
تابع() ضروری است. تابعی که باید عنصر پوشاننده را تعیین کند را مشخص کنید.

مثال‌های بیشتر

از عنصر جدید برای پوشاندن استفاده کنید
یک عنصر جدید DOM ایجاد کنید تا هر عنصر انتخاب شده را بپوشاند.